2. Collect Required Documents
A complete set of documents is necessary for your application. The requirements might vary slightly by state, however generally, you'll need:
| Document | Description |
|---|---|
| Identity Document | Legitimate passport or EU identity card |
| Proof of Residency | Registration certificate (Anmeldebestätigung) |
| Biometric Passport Photo | Current image, normally size 35mm x 45mm |
| Medical Certificate | Verification of physical fitness to drive |
| Eye Test Certificate | Confirming you satisfy vision requirements |
| Application | Available at your local driver's license authority (Führerscheinstelle) |
| Fee Payment | Differs depending upon the state |
3. Go To a Driving School (if appropriate)
For individuals without prior driving experience, enrolling in a driving school (Fahrschule) is required. Here are some key aspects of the procedure at a driving school:
- Theory Classes: Prepare for the theoretical examination by attending classes that cover traffic rules, policies, and safe driving practices.
- Practical Lessons: Students will take practical driving lessons with a licensed instructor, culminating in the roadway test.
4. Take the Theoretical Exam
As soon as you complete your theory classes, the next action is to pass the theoretical test. This examination generally consists of multiple-choice concerns and covers numerous elements of driving laws and security.
5. Take the Practical Driving Test
After effectively passing the theoretical examination, you will be qualified to take the useful driving test. Throughout the test, you will be examined on your capability to run the car and stick to traffic regulations.
6. Send Your Application
Once you have actually passed both the theoretical and practical tests, you can submit your application for the driving license, in addition to all needed documents and the payment for the license cost.

Frequently asked questions
Q1: How long does it take to acquire a German driving license?
A1: The duration differs based upon specific readiness, but it normally takes a couple of months from the start of your driving lessons to acquiring the license.
Q2: Can I utilize my foreign driving license in Germany?
A2: Yes, if your foreign driving license is valid and issued in an EU/EEA nation. Nevertheless, if you are a long-term citizen, you might need to convert it.
Q3: What if I have a driving license from a non-EU country?
A3: In a lot of cases, you will require to take the theoretical and dry runs to acquire a German driving license.
Q4: How much does it cost to get a German driving license?
A4: The total expense can vary from EUR1,500 to EUR3,000, depending on the driving school, lessons required, and testing charges.
Q5: Is it essential to learn German to obtain a German driving license?
A5: While it's possible to discover driving schools that provide lessons in English, a fundamental understanding of German is helpful for passing the theoretical test.
